            1 .TH BLIND-ARITHM 1 blind
            2 .SH NAME
            3 blind-arithm - Perform simple arithmetic on a video
            4 .SH SYNOPSIS
            5 .B blind-arithm
            6 [-axyz]
            7 .I operation
            8 .IR right-hand-stream \ ...
            9 .SH DESCRIPTION
           10 .B blind-arithm
           11 reads left-hand operands from stdin, and right-hand
           12 operands from
           13 .IR right-hand-stream ,
           14 and perform the choosen
           15 .I operation
           16 over the read values and prints the resulting video
           17 to stdout.
           18 The operation with operands from the same colour
           19 parameters on the sames pixels on the same frames
           20 on the two videos.
           21 .P
           22 If stdin is longer than
           23 .IR right-hand-stream ,
           24 the remainder of stdin is printed without any changes.
           25 If stdin is shorter than
           26 .IR right-hand-stream ,
           27 the remainder of
           28 .I right-hand-stream
           29 is ignored but may be partially read.
           30 .P
           31 IF multiple
           32 .I right-hand-stream
           33 are specified, they are applied from left to right,
           34 with the exception for if        
           35 .I operation
           36 is
           37 .BR exp ,
           38 in which case they are applied from right to left with
           39 stdin applied last.
           40 .SH OPERATIONS
           41 .TP
           42 .B add
           43 Calculate the sum of the operands.
           44 .TP
           45 .B sub
           46 Subtract the right-hand operand from the left-hand operand.
           47 .TP
           48 .B mul
           49 Calculate the product of the operands.
           50 .TP
           51 .B div
           52 Divide the left-hand operand by the right-hand operand.
           53 .TP
           54 .B mod
           55 Calculate the modulus of left-hand operand and the right-hand operand.
           56 The result is always non-negative.
           57 .TP
           58 .B exp
           59 Raise the left-hand operand to the
           60 .IR n th
           61 operand, where
           62 .I n
           63 is the value of the right-hand operand.
           64 .TP
           65 .B log
           66 Calculate the logarithm of the left-hand operand
           67 and divide it by the logarithm of the rigth-hand operand.
           68 .TP
           69 .B min
           70 Select the lowest operand.
           71 .TP
           72 .B max
           73 Select the highest operand.
           74 .TP
           75 .B abs
           76 Calculate the the sum of absolute value of the left-hand
           77 operand subtracted by the right-hand operand, and the
           78 right-hand operand
           79 .SH OPTIONS
           80 .TP
           81 .B -a
           82 Do not modify the alpha channel (the fourth channel).
           83 .TP
           84 .B -x
           85 Do not modify the X channel (the first channel).
           86 .TP
           87 .B -y
           88 Do not modify the Y channel (the second channel).
           89 .TP
           90 .B -z
           91 Do not modify the Z channel (the third channel).
